RTV, the San Marinese national broadcaster, has confirmed there were 585 applications for ‘Una voce per San Marino’ and the 2022 Eurovision Song Contest. 299 of the applications were for the emerging artists, who have currently been attending castings for the Semi Finals. Following the announcement that Opatija will continue to host Dora until at least 2024, HRT, the Croatian national broadcaster, have announced that Dora 2022 will take place on Saturday 19th February. PBS, the Maltese national broadcaster, have set the dates for this year’s Malta Eurovision Song Contest. The national selection has returned for the 2022 Eurovision Song Contest.
